FC Goa vs. Al-Seeb FC: AFC Champions League Two Clash for Group Stage Spot
Indian club FC Goa face Oman’s Al-Seeb FC in the preliminary round of the 2025–26 AFC Champions League Two on August 13 in Goa, with the winner earning a coveted group-stage berth and a chance to face giants like Al-Nassr.
image for illustrative purpose

FC Goa return to continental competition this August 13, hosting Al-Seeb FC of Oman at Goa’s Fatorda Stadium in a high-stakes AFC Champions League Two preliminary playoff. The victor will book their place in the group stage, joining renowned clubs across Asia—including Al-Nassr, led by Cristiano Ronaldo.
Historic Return: This is Goa’s first appearance in AFC competitions since featuring in the Champions League group stage in 2021.
Road to Asia: Their Super Cup win earned them this continental berth.
What’s at Stake: A victory grants access to the ACL Two group stage, raising the club's international profile.
About the Opponents: Al-Seeb FC
Rise in Omani Football: Founded in 1972 and registering officially in 2002, Al-Seeb have dominated domestic competitions—winning four of the last six league titles and four Sultan Qaboos Cups.
Continental Glory: Their biggest success came in 2022, when they won the AFC Cup (now Champions League Two), completing a treble in the same season.
Head-to-Head & Tactical Landscape
First Meeting: It’s the debut clash between these clubs, and Al-Seeb’s first encounter with an Indian outfit.
Tactical Setup: Under coach Nikola Djurovic, Al-Seeb typically deploy a balanced 4-2-3-1 system that blends offensive prowess with defensive stability.

Coach’s Corner
FC Goa’s head coach Manolo Márquez has expressed unwavering belief in his squad’s ability to overcome Al-Seeb, despite acknowledging the opponents’ strength.
